    Administrative Divisions of Haryana. Haryana, formed on 1 November 1966, is a state in North India. For the administrative purpose, Haryana is divided into 6 revenue divisions which are further divided into 22 districts. For Law and Order maintenance, it is divided into 5 Police Ranges and 4 Police Commissionerates.

    The Haryana Legislative Assembly ( Hindi: Haryana Vidhan Sabha) is the unicameral legislature of Indian state of Haryana. The seating of the assembly is at Chandigarh, the capital of the state. There are 90 seats in the house filled by direct election using a single-member first-past-the-post system. The term of office is five years.

    Rajesh Khullar. Rajesh Khullar (born 31 August 1963) is an Indian bureaucrat and Chief Principal Secretary to Chief Minister, Haryana. [1] Previously, he was Executive Director at the World Bank Group representing India, Bangladesh, Bhutan, and Sri Lanka. [2] [3] [4] Khullar is a retired 1988 batch Indian Administrative Service (IAS) officer.
